Fidessa directors offload shares

Thu, 25th Feb 2010 16:44

Financial software provider Fidessa's chief executive and chairman have sold shares less than one week before they go ex-dividend. Fidessa announced a 40p a share special dividend when it published its 2009 figures at the beginning of last week. This is in addition to a 20p a share final dividend paid at the same time. The ex-dividend date is 3 March. Chief executive Chris Aspinwall sold 250,000 shares earlier today at 1385p a share. Finance director John Hamer sold 100,000 shares at the same price. Aspinwall raised £3.46m and still owns 1.36% of Fidessa and Hamer raised £1.385m and retains 0.71% of the company. Last October, Aspinwall raised £1.95m from a share disposal and Hamer £975,000. The sales were at 1300p a share. This means that Aspinwall has raised more than £5.4m from sales in this tax year and Hamer has raised £2.36m. Aspinwall has been with Fidessa since 1986 and became chief executive in 2001, while Hamer became chairman in the same year having started with the company in 1983. Hamer was the previous chief executive.The 2009 results were better than forecast but the growth rate is expected to fall as the number of customers declines due to consolidation. Revenues improved 26% to £238.5m in 2009, although that is flattered by foreign exchange movements. Underlying profit rose by nearly one-third to £31m. Profits are expected to approach £40m in 2010.
